Many states have passed laws that govern the use of drones. However, others have not yet adopted them. Illinois recently passed SB2167. The bill prohibits the use of drones in state parks without permission. It also sets forth privacy rights and outlines what rules are required for commercial and recreational drone operators. What are the rules and regulations for drones operation?

Registering your drone with FAA is required. This registration process includes submitting information about the device, including its weight, size, battery capacity, and operating frequency. The FAA will issue you an identification number.
